Poitevin vs Staghound

Poitevin
Hound
The Poitevin is a refined French hound known for its exceptional hunting skills, athleticism, and melodious voice. With a rich history and a loyal temperament, this breed thrives on exercise and engagement, making it an ideal companion for active families.

Staghound
Hound
The Staghound is an athletic and gentle breed, originally bred for hunting. Known for their speed and loyalty, they thrive in active families.
